I'm afraid that I just don't see this feature ever happening unless
someone out there sends in a patch for it.  I don't have the time
to even think about how to solve this for now...  The final solution
here is PROBABLY going to be related to the fix to the "Assign splits
to customers" <http://bugzilla.gnome.org/show_bug.cgi?id=108570>
and then you could enter a split-transaction in the register and
assign each split to each customer.

> I am a service provider. Interpreter. I work for several entities in
> the course of one day - and I also do subcontract work for an
> agency. The agency, depending on the type of job (there are two types)
> pays a different rate - and pays on different time lines. Invoices go
> to the company every day that I do work for them but payment will be
> made for some jobs in two weeks and for other jobs in 30 days.
>
> Arbitrarily complex... but it is what my current receivables system
> looks like.
>
> I do not know what it would take to make GNUCash show a list of
> invoices and let you "reconcile" those that have been paid with this
> check... and not applying payment to those that have not been paid -
> I'm not a programmer (sigh... you have me captive!)
